Key Responsibilities:
Electrical Design & Drafting:
- Create electrical design layouts, schematics, and detailed drawings for a variety of electrical systems, including power distribution, lighting, communication systems, and control systems.
- Develop design solutions based on project requirements, industry standards, and regulatory guidelines.
- Perform calculations and simulations to determine the proper specifications for electrical components and systems.
- Ensure all electrical designs adhere to safety, environmental, and industry standards (e.g., NEC, IEC, etc.).
- Update and modify existing electrical designs as necessary to reflect changes in project scope or specifications.
Collaboration with Engineering Teams:
- Work closely with senior electrical engineers and multidisciplinary teams to ensure electrical designs are integrated effectively with other aspects of the project, such as mechanical, civil, and structural designs.
- Attend project meetings and provide technical support during the design, implementation, and construction phases.
- Provide input on the selection of electrical equipment, materials, and systems, ensuring compatibility with the overall project requirements.
Documentation & Reporting:
- Prepare and maintain technical documentation, including design specifications, reports, and as-built drawings.
- Assist in the preparation of design packages, technical proposals, and other project-related documents.
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of design changes, revisions, and approvals.
- Prepare detailed material take-offs (MTO) and bill of materials (BOM) for electrical systems.
Quality Assurance & Compliance:
- Ensure that all electrical designs are compliant with relevant codes, standards, and safety regulations.
- Conduct design reviews and quality checks to identify and resolve any design issues or inconsistencies.
- Participate in design audits and inspections to verify that electrical systems are installed according to the approved designs.
- Maintain a strong focus on quality control throughout the design process, ensuring accuracy and consistency.
